2010年10月自考数据库系统原理试题解析
需积分: 25 65 浏览量
更新于2024-09-12
1
收藏 74KB DOC 举报
"2010年10月自考数据库系统原理试题及答案"
这份资源是2010年10月高等教育自学考试数据库系统原理科目的试题及答案,适用于准备参加此类考试的学生进行复习和自我测试。试题涵盖了数据库系统的基础概念、设计和管理等方面的知识。
1. 数据库系统的物理独立性:这是数据库管理系统提供的一种特性,允许用户在不改变应用程序的情况下,更改数据的物理存储方式。B选项“模式/内模式映像”负责这种独立性,确保逻辑数据视图与实际存储方式之间的转换。
2. 实体集之间的联系:实体集A与实体集B之间具有多对多的关系,意味着A中的每个实体可以与B中的多个实体相关联,反之亦然。C选项正确地描述了这种关系类型。
3. 数据库物理设计:这个阶段涉及数据库的实际存储结构和存取方法,而不包括优化模式,这是逻辑设计阶段的任务。B选项“存储记录结构设计”、C选项“确定数据存放位置”和D选项“存取方法设计”都是物理设计的一部分,而A选项“优化模式”不是。
4. 实体完整性规则:在WORK关系中,主码(ENO,CNO)都不能取空值,这意味着这两个字段是必填的,以保证数据的完整性。D选项正确表达了这一规则。
5. 函数依赖:X→Y表示在关系模式R的所有实例中,如果X值相同,则Y值也必须相同。B选项正确解释了函数依赖的语义。
6. 无损分解:如果分解ρ={R1,…,RK}对关系模式R上的函数依赖集F是无损的,那么在R上满足F的所有关系都可以被分解为ρ,并且能重新组合成原始关系。A选项“无损分解”正确描述了这一概念。
7. 关系R和S的运算:R-S的结果是通过从R中去除所有与S中匹配的行得到的。B选项正确表示了这种差异。
8. 自然连接和等值连接的比较:自然连接基于公共属性进行等值连接,并移除重复的属性,而等值连接不一定需要公共属性,也不一定去除重复属性。D选项指出了它们在处理重复属性上的区别。
9. SQL表达式:AGENOTBETWEEN18AND24表示年龄不在18到24之间,等价于年龄小于18或大于24。D选项正确表示了这个条件。
以上内容详细解释了自考数据库系统原理试题中涉及的关键知识点,包括数据库的独立性级别、实体间的关系、数据库设计、实体完整性、函数依赖、关系模式的分解、SQL操作以及查询表达式。这些知识是理解和操作数据库系统的基础,对于学习数据库管理和开发至关重要。
点击了解资源详情
点击了解资源详情
124 浏览量
225 浏览量
2022-03-05 上传
2010-10-19 上传
2010-10-19 上传
2010-04-08 上传
monkey_lll
- 粉丝: 0
- 资源: 8
最新资源
- O2IXLB_oopJavaGyak:Java任务解决方案
- 拉格朗日插值:是-matlab开发
- MariaDB,mysql 数据库驱动下载
- 木质展示柜3d模型
- KainoAfricaApp:演示我们应用开发的移动应用
- 电信设备-一种具有无线通信功能的LED地埋灯.zip
- 主管会计岗位任务绩效考核指标
- Complete-ML-Coursework
- ema-john-server:heroku部署
- tibia-tools:一组用于胫骨的工具
- 现代家装3D设计
- Husky-开源
- 幅移键控:数字调制 ASK-matlab开发
- Unity 手机震动插件Vibration
- 职位说明书-项目助理DOC
- dotfiles:我的dotfiles